Pay range, side by side
| Percentile | Auditor | Investment Banker |
|---|---|---|
| Entry (10th) | $22,303 | $32,837 |
| 25th | $27,648 | $52,111 |
| Median | $32,993 | $71,385 |
| 75th | $39,526 | $94,943 |
| Senior (90th) | $46,059 | $118,500 |
National Thailand figures in THB. Individual pay varies with experience, employer, and location.
